Answer #1

Answer: a. Carbocation c

Carbocation c which is a secondary carbocation which can undergo hydride shift to form a more stable tertiary carbocation.

Hydride Shift

In the case of carbocation a, it can undergo methyl shift to form a more stable tertiary carbocation, but not hydride shift.

Carbocation b which is already a secondary carbocation, can leads to another secondary carbocation formation through hydride shift.

Carbocation d is already a more stable tertiary carbocation. On hydride shift, it will results the formation of less stable secondary carbocation .
